Abstract | This paper focuses on the experiences of six Chilean female headteachers. It addresses their career progress, and the facilitators and barriers, as well as the challenges they encountered in accessing and enacting school leadership. The six participants were drawn from all three of Chile's school types -- public, semi-private and private -- in what is a differentiated system. The findings demonstrate both differences and similarities in participants' experiences, across all three school sectors. A major difference relates to the additional barriers faced by public sector school leaders, compared with participants in the private and semi-private schools. (As Provided). |
